LED Lighting used in Retail Outlet...Improves Sales

SVEN'S COMFORT SHOES

  

Sven's Shoes was established in 1974. Located in Chisago City, MN, Sven's produces over 20,000 pairs of shoes annually. Many of these are custom shoes, and have even been seen on the feet of Hollywood stars! Sven's has made and sold their products out of their factory/retail shop for most of these years, but when an opportunity to separate their retail operation became available, company President and owner Marie Rivers jumped at the chance. When it came to lighting her new store, Marie called Premier Lighting.

 

 

Sven's new store, formerly a car wash that was totally renovated to meet Rivers' and Sven's needs, is 2,200 square feet including storage area. Rivers has long had an interest in LED lighting and elected to explore that option with Premier. The original location lighting produced excessive heat which stressed the A/C and consumed a lot of energy.

 

Sven's has used LED lighting on a selective basis previously, but quickly determined that mixed lighting sources, unless appropriately designed, does not produce a good effect. Premier partnered with Juno Lighting to explain the uses and benefits of LED in retail applications beyond obvious energy savings. And Rivers saw first-hand how lighting can impact and influence retail sales. She relates, "The impact of lighting upon sales is enormous! Inappropriate lighting will make great products look bad.   And it is sad to see situations where the lighting hurts the sale."

 

Sven's also enjoys the other benefits of LED: cooler operating temperatures which tax the cooling system less, economical operation, maintenance savings, reduced recycling costs and simply an easier visual impact on both the customer and the employee.

 

Sven's LED

 

Rivers says the LED improves the overall lighting of her store (which is brighter) and this is easier on the eyes, making the employee's job easier which ultimately improves morale and thus productivity. Everyone, employees and customer alike, are more comfortable with the LED lighting.

While rebates from Xcel Energy were a consideration, they were not as important as the other LED benefits: the rebates were the "frosting on the cake."

 

As far as recommending LED to other retail outlets, Rivers states, "listen to your resources! When options are offered, listen. An owner needs to look at the long term versus short term cost. With the benefits and savings, why not do this?"

 

Sven's finds LED lighting to be positive at all levels. Some of the benefits may not be as great as the others, but they can make big differences on sales and the bottom line!

Xcel Energy, LED Rebates...Changes

Changes to LED Rebates Effective August 1st

 

Xcel's rebate programs are designed to encourage the use of energy-efficient equipment. As the pricing and market share of high-efficiency products change and new technologies emerge, Xcel periodically adjust the structure and value of their rebate programs.  Changes to Xcel Lighting Efficiency rebate programs include new rebates, adjusted rebate levels and revised requirements.

Changes to sensors:

Occupancy Sensors*** -- Revised Requirements
Occupancy sensor technologies have advanced in the last few years and now it is fairly easy and cost effective to purchase fixtures that include an occupancy sensor. As a result, the rebate levels we currently provide for retrofits are no longer appropriate relative to the market cost of the equipment. To address market conditions, we have added a connected load requirement and reduced rebate levels for wall and ceiling sensors as follows.

NEW REBATES:

 

Stairwell Fixtures with Integrated Occupancy Sensors*
This rebate is designed to apply to lighting projects which utilize either fluorescent fixtures that have one or two 4' T8 lamps that are controlled, and a 2' T8 lamp that is on continuously; or LED fixtures that are 20W to 30W with step-dimming capabilities. These fixtures are most commonly used in stairwells, but are also appropriate for hallways or anywhere a minimal amount of lighting is required at all times.

ENERGY STAR®-qualified LED Downlight Retrofit Fixtures*

 

ENERGY STAR now offers what we consider a hybrid lamp/fixture. The product includes the housing for a recessed down lamp, however, unlike fixtures that need to be hardwired, this fixture can be installed using an Edison or GU base. The cost of this category of products is substantially lower than hardwired fixtures. Therefore, we've created a new rebate specifically for these fixtures which may be used in both retrofit and new construction projects. These fixtures are listed on the Energy Star LED Commercial Downlight luminaire list as the Fixture Type named "Downlight Solid State Retrofit".
